/*https://practice.geeksforgeeks.org/problems/269f61832b146dd5e6d89b4ca18cbd2a2654ebbe/1/*/
//BFS approach
class Cell implements Comparable<Cell>
{
int r, c;
Cell(int r, int c)
{
this.r = r;
this.c = c;
}
public int compareTo(Cell c)
{
return 0;
}
}
class Solution{
public int helpaterp(int[][] hospital) {
int time = 0;
int R = hospital.length;
int C = hospital[0].length;
Queue<Cell> queue = new LinkedList<Cell>();
//add infected wards to the queue
for (int i = 0; i < R; ++i)
{
for (int j = 0; j < C; ++j)
{
if (hospital[i][j] == 2)
{
queue.add(new Cell(i,j));
}
}
}
//till the queue becomes empty
while (!queue.isEmpty())
{
//initialize a boolean variable to indicate new infections in this iteration
boolean isInfected = false;
//for the currently infected wards
int len = queue.size();
for (int i = 0; i < len; ++i)
{
//get the infected cell
Cell c = queue.poll();
//check if any adjacent cells can be infected and mark it
if (c.r+1 < R && hospital[c.r+1][c.c] == 1)
{
isInfected = true;
hospital[c.r+1][c.c] = 2;
queue.add(new Cell(c.r+1,c.c));
}
if (c.c+1 < C && hospital[c.r][c.c+1] == 1)
{
isInfected = true;
hospital[c.r][c.c+1] = 2;
queue.add(new Cell(c.r,c.c+1));
}
if (c.r-1 >= 0 && hospital[c.r-1][c.c] == 1)
{
isInfected = true;
hospital[c.r-1][c.c] = 2;
queue.add(new Cell(c.r-1,c.c));
}
if (c.c-1 >= 0 && hospital[c.r][c.c-1] == 1)
{
isInfected = true;
hospital[c.r][c.c-1] = 2;
queue.add(new Cell(c.r,c.c-1));
}
}
//if new infections occured, increase time
if (isInfected) ++time;
}
//if any uninfected patient present, store -1 in time
for (int i = 0; i < R; ++i)
{
for (int j = 0; j < C; ++j)
{
if (hospital[i][j] == 1)
{
time = -1;
break;
}
}
}
return time;
}
}
